Agartala, September 09, 2023: Two individuals named Liton Das (35) and Liza Akhter (22) have sustained serious injuries after a collision with a black Thar car on Bishalgarh Bypass. The victims are currently receiving medical treatment at GB Hospital, sparking renewed fears among Bishalgarh residents regarding the involvement of black Thar vehicles in criminal activities within the area.
The incident took place on Saturday morning when a black Thar, bearing the registration number TR01BX-0333, was observed traveling at high speed along Bishalgarh Bypass. The vehicle collided forcefully with an auto-rickshaw, causing it to overturn. The collision left Liton Das and Liza Akhter with severe injuries.
Local residents, alerted by the loud crash, rushed to the scene, and valiantly rescued the injured victims before promptly transporting them to Bishalgarh Sub-Divisional Hospital for initial medical attention.
Preliminary reports suggest that the black Thar car was allegedly speeding, leading to the unfortunate accident. Concerns regarding black Thar vehicles in Bishalgarh have been mounting due to reported associations with criminal activities, including robberies, at various locations within the town.
Subsequently, both injured individuals were transferred to GB Hospital following initial treatment at Bishalgarh Sub-Divisional Hospital under the supervision of attending medical professionals. Authorities are investigating the circumstances surrounding the accident and the potential role of speeding in the incident.
